Review Of Structural Color In The Genus Chrysochroa Dejean, 1833 (Coleoptera: Buprestidae), Able Chow
Review Of Structural Color In The Genus Chrysochroa Dejean, 1833 (Coleoptera: Buprestidae), Able Chow
LSU Master's Theses
The jewel beetles, (Coleoptera: Buprestidae Leach, 1815), is the eighth most speciose coleopteran family, with the majority of its members possessing diverse bright, saturated structural coloration of multilayer origin. This study focuses on the genus Chrysochroa Dejean, 1833, which includes some of the most brilliantly and charismatically colored buprestid species. While members of Chrysochroa are prised by entomologists amateurs and professional and are well-represented in museum collections, the evolution and ecology of their structural color remain underexplored. Regional Expansion And Evaluation Of Potential Chemical Control For Invasive Apple Snails (Pomacea Maculata) In Southwest Louisiana, Julian M. Lucero
Regional Expansion And Evaluation Of Potential Chemical Control For Invasive Apple Snails (Pomacea Maculata) In Southwest Louisiana, Julian M. Lucero
LSU Master's Theses
The integration of monitoring and chemical control is an efficient strategy for managing invasive apple snails, Pomacea maculata, in the rice (Oryza sativa L.) and crawfish systems of southwest Louisiana. However, their current distribution, expansion rates, and susceptibility to chemical control methods in this area are not well known. This study evaluated the expansion of P. maculata in southwest Louisiana and assessed potential chemical control for P. maculata among toxicity assays using various application rates. Mosquito Distribution And Stoichiometric Analysis Between Open And Closed Canopies In New Orleans Cemeteries, Rachel Rogers
Mosquito Distribution And Stoichiometric Analysis Between Open And Closed Canopies In New Orleans Cemeteries, Rachel Rogers
LSU Master's Theses
Cemetery vases represent an important container habitat for mosquito larvae. Some species, like, Aedes albopictus and Aedes aegypti, prefer container habitats, whereas others, like Culex quinquefasciatus, will opportunistically use containers. In New Orleans, these three medically important vector species (Ae. albopictus Ae. aegypti, and Cx. quinquefasciatus) co-occur, despite a demonstrated competitive advantage of Ae. albopictus to the other two. Here we test the hypothesis that canopy cover from trees could be a mediating factor in driving mosquito assemblages in New Orleans, by influencing food sources, and the microclimate experienced by mosquito larvae.
